How to Grow Curly Hair: 9 Must-Know Tips

How to Grow Curly Hair: 9 Must-Know Tips

Are you longing for long, healthy curly hair? Having healthy curly and coily hair can be a rewarding journey, but it requires patience, proper care, and expert advice.

In this guide, we'll share top tips to help you grow and maintain healthy curls. Let's embark on your journey to healthy hair care.

1. Nourish from Within

Your hair's growth starts on the inside. A balanced diet rich in vitamins and minerals is crucial for healthy hair. Experts recommend a diet with plenty of protein, omega-3 fatty acids, biotin, and vitamins A, C, and E. These nutrients help strengthen your hair follicles and promote natural curl growth. 2. Handle with Care

Curly hair is more fragile and prone to breakage. Treat it with care. Avoid tight hairstyles and excessive brushing. Better still, when you do comb your hair, do it while wet and with a good amount of product to avoid any tension to the hair. When detangling, use a wide-tooth comb, like a wide tooth shower comb or your fingers to prevent damage. Remember, less manipulation means less breakage and better growth.

3. Hydration is Key

Keeping your curls well-hydrated is essential. Use a sulfate-free, moisturizing shampoo and conditioner. Deep conditioning treatments can work wonders, replenishing moisture and repairing damage. Experts recommend weekly or bi-weekly deep conditioning sessions, especially in colder months. 

4. Trim Regularly

While it may seem counterintuitive, regular trims help your curls grow healthier. Trimming removes split ends, preventing them from traveling up the hair shaft and causing further damage. Aim for a trim every 6-8 weeks to maintain your curls' vitality, although this may slightly change depending on your texture and curl type.

5. Protect Your Curls

Shield your curls from external damage. Invest in a silk or satin bonnet or pillowcase to reduce friction while you sleep. Limit heat styling and opt for heat protectant products when necessary. UV protection is also crucial, so consider wearing a hat when you're out in the sun.

6. Embrace the Curly Girl Method

The Curly Girl Method otherwise known as the CG Method, is a tried-and-true approach to curly hair care. It encourages the use of sulfate-free products, minimal heat, and no harsh chemicals, found in some hair products and hair dyes. Following this method can help you maintain your hair's natural curl pattern and foster healthy growth.

7. Invest in the Right Tools

Investing in the right curly hair tools can help promote healthy hair and length retention. Tools like a scalp massager stimulate blood flow to the scalp, which helps in delivering essential nutrients to the hair follicles. This increased circulation aids in the growth and overall health of the hair. Likewise, swapping out your traditional cotton towels and instead using microfiber towel on your hair which are gentler on your curls, are just some of the ways to reduce breakage and promote hair health and length retention.   


8. Embrace the Shrinkage

Even if you are looking to grow your hair, it's important to understand that with healthy curl hair, comes shrinkage. Shrinkage in curly hair is actually a positive sign of hair health and vitality. When healthy curls are well-hydrated and properly cared for, they tend to coil up, appearing shorter than they actually are. This is a sign that the hair is retaining moisture, which is crucial for maintaining elasticity and preventing breakage.

It's essential to understand that all curly hair types are different, and the degree of shrinkage can vary significantly from person to person. Embracing the natural shrinkage of your curls is an acknowledgment of their health and resilience. Rather than being disheartened by the apparent lack of length, it's important to appreciate the beauty and vibrancy of your unique curls, knowing that they are thriving and flourishing in their natural state.


9. Be Patience and Consistent

Growing natural curls is a journey that requires time and consistent care. You won't see immediate results, but staying committed to your hair care routine is key. Be patient and let your hair thrive naturally.
